CoinTrade, founded on October 10, 2017, is an investment firm that specializes in cryptocurrency and financial market trading. Initially emerging from the growing interest in digital currencies, CoinTrade has positioned itself as a player in the online trading space, providing access to various financial markets.
CoinTrade operates under the umbrella of Twingle Consulting Ltd., which manages its operations and strategic direction. However, details regarding the ownership structure remain vague, with limited transparency about the actual individuals behind the company.
The company is registered in Dominica, specifically at 8 Copthall, Roseau Valley, 00152. This location is often associated with offshore financial activities, which can raise concerns regarding regulatory oversight.
CoinTrade offers its trading services globally, allowing users from various countries to access its platform. However, the lack of regulatory approval in major financial jurisdictions limits its credibility.
Despite its global reach, CoinTrade is not regulated by any major financial authority. This absence of oversight is a significant red flag for potential investors and traders, as it raises concerns about the safety and security of client funds.

CoinTrade is not regulated by any recognized financial authority, including Level 1, Level 2, or Level 3 regulators. This absence of oversight is a significant risk factor for potential investors.
CoinTrade operates as an offshore entity, making it challenging to ascertain its legal standing in various jurisdictions. The company does not provide clear information about its legal structure across different regions.
Due to the lack of regulation, there are no established client fund protection measures in place. This poses a risk to investors who may face difficulties in recovering their funds in case of disputes.
CoinTrade offers its services globally but faces restrictions in several countries due to regulatory concerns. Users should verify the legality of trading with CoinTrade in their respective jurisdictions.
The company has faced scrutiny from financial regulators in various countries, with warnings issued for fraudulent activities. This history raises concerns about its compliance and operational integrity.
